About Lin Klein

Lin Klein is a scholar working on Small Animals, Equine, Surgery, Pulmonary and Respiratory Medicine and Molecular Biology, having authored 21 papers that have together received 290 indexed citations. Recurring topics across this work include Veterinary Pharmacology and Anesthesia (10 papers), Veterinary Equine Medical Research (8 papers), Veterinary Oncology Research (3 papers), Microbial infections and disease research (2 papers), Pain Mechanisms and Treatments (2 papers), Ion channel regulation and function (2 papers), Anesthesia and Pain Management (2 papers) and Muscle metabolism and nutrition (1 paper). The work is most often cited by research in Equine (83 citations), Small Animals (128 citations), Virology (25 citations), Animal Science and Zoology (24 citations) and Anesthesiology and Pain Medicine (10 citations). Lin Klein has collaborated with scholars based in United States, Cyprus and Greece. Frequent co-authors include J. Daniel Sherman, Henry Rosenberg, Midge Leitch, Amir N. Hamir, Lawrence R. Soma, Dean W. Richardson, J. Ty Hopkins, David M. Nunamaker, Michael W. Ross and James A. Orsini. Their work appears in journals such as Journal of the American Veterinary Medical Association, Veterinary Surgery, American Journal of Veterinary Research, Veterinary Clinics of North America Equine Practice and Virology.
